I have the following problem, I can not a dd created hard disk images not in Autopsy 4.3.0 not read. I keep getting the message "Can not Determine File System".
Something to the facts.
I have wanted to sort out some hard disks and wanted or have deleted the disks with the tool "DBAN - Darik's Boot and Nuke" (live cd). It was indeed very easy to disconnect my "normal" hard disk from the motherboard, but there were so far no problems. But all of a sudden ... I just turned around and the tool has automatically selected the hard disk for some reason and started data destruction. I immediately pulled the plug from the PC, but Windows 7 no longer starts. I then connected the disk via USB to another PC, but the disk is only displayed in RAW mode. For security reasons, I then created a disk image with Linux (dd) and wanted to restore the data using the Testdisk tool. At least I tried. The image can neither mount (mount) nor access it. With foremost, scalpel, photo_rec, etc., certain data, such as pictures, music can be read, but of course only with cryptic names. I have tried various tools and have found that, among other things, the Hetman NTFS recovery and getbackdata can read the hard disk (even) MIT directory structure.
The getbackdata program has been able to determine that an NTFS system is present as of Sector 206.848. - further information can be found in the lower part of the lecture.
The progarms, such as mmls, fls or fsstat, only display the error "Can not determine file system type".
I guess times that the partition table is defective, because otherwise the above Windows programs no data could recognize.
Now to the technical basic data:
It is a 320 GB hard drive from Samsung.
